Getting Started
If you are likely to try your hands on cooking the very first time, it is advisable to select the recipes which are not too complicated, as you wouldn’t normally love to be overwhelmed by the recipe with unusual ingredients or difficult steps. Read the entire cooking recipe carefully before starting, and make sure you have each of the ingredients, appliances and utensils ready.
Understanding all the directions is essential, and be sure that you’ve got plenty of time to finish if off within the time you might have available. Collect all of the ingredients in one place, and measure each ingredient before cooking. Always wash the hands with warm water and wear an apron just before cooking. Deal meticulously with raw meat, fish, poultry and egg products.

Trying Your Own Cooking Recipes
Once you commence feeling confident with cooking, you can get creative by experimenting with some ingredients such as substituting beans for carrots or beans for meats, and the like. You can also make use of various seasonings, as every one of them gives different flavours and aromas. Try tinkering with different textures and colours inside meals. You can take one type of dish and learn a lot of variations. Try some international recipes also for example Chinese, Indian, Italian, Spanish, Continental and southern cooking recipes.
